Output e3cad0481cc24f03bf1e6117a373dcdce11368ebe32c95c9b79da4fb3f742595:2

value
54786781821
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1fd23c7cf56ca190eab0d4a1af97a2f43cd2c78d0fd8b0993c7174164e1e262e
address
tb1prlfrcl84djsep64s6js6l9az7s7d93udplvtpxfuw96pvns7ychqc3w2l8
transaction
e3cad0481cc24f03bf1e6117a373dcdce11368ebe32c95c9b79da4fb3f742595
confirmations
66835
spent
true